admin 管理员组文章数量: 887021
2024年1月13日发(作者:asp论坛限制别人看)
龙源期刊网
基于MVC的高职院校毕业生信息管理系统的设计与实现
作者:强鹤群 钱春花 吴亚美 赵山山
来源:《电脑知识与技术》2013年第12期
摘要:该文以苏州农业职业技术学院为例,基于MVC架构对高职院校毕业生管理系统的设计和实现进行了探讨,主要内容如下:1)设计了利用JAVA Web技术搭建信息管理平台的方式来解决毕业生信息网络化管理问题。2)研究了系统实现的关键技术,包括MVC设计模式,Hibernate数据持久化,Struts 2 框架,JSP视图层开发。3)利用MyEclipse、Tomcat、SQL Server等工具了完成了原型系统的开发。该文所设计的系统已经为苏州农业职业技术学院的毕业生信息管理提供了有效的借鉴。
关键词:毕业生信息管理;MVC设计模式;Struts 2框架;Hibernate框架
中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2013)12-2807-03
随着现代网络技术和高校校园网的建设与发展,基于校园内局域网和Internet的应用系统开发正蓬勃发展,高校管理工作的信息化、数字化研究与实践越来越受到重视。毕业生信息管理工作是高职院校教育教学管理的重要组成部分,随着国内各高校办学规模的不断扩大,高校毕业生数量大量增加,建立高校毕业生信息管理系统日趋重要和必要。
在上述应用需求背景下,本研究对苏州农业职业技术学院毕业生信息管理现状进行了较为深入的调研和分析,在参考业内各种就业平台设计基础上,给出了基于MVC的高职毕业生信息管理系统的设计与实现。
1 MVC设计模式的应用
MVC是三个单词的缩写,分别为: 模型(Model),视图(View)和控制器(Controller)。其架构如图1所示。
模型(Model):表示数据和业务处理。由于应用于模型的代码只需要写一次就可以被多个视图重用,所以减少了代码的重复性。对应的组件是JavcBean(Java类)。视图(View):是用户看到并与之交互的界面。MVC一个大的好处是它能为应用程序处理很多不同的视图。对应的组件是JSP或HTML文件。控制器(Controller):接受用户的输入并调用模型和视图区完成用户的请求。对应的组件是Servlet。
本文在系统设计开发中采用JavaBean和Hibernate实现模型层开发,采用Struts 2实现控制层开发,采用JSP技术实现视图层开发。
版权声明:本文标题:基于MVC的高职院校毕业生信息管理系统的设计与实现 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/jishu/1705080366h472417.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论